Long Beach, CA (Sunday, April 16, 2023) – Dale Coyne Racing with RWR driver Sting Ray Robb (#51 Biohaven) was looking to move forward in the Acura Grand Prix of Long Beach on Sunday and that’s what he did after climbing to 18th from his 21st place on the starting grid.
Started: 21st
Finished: 18th
- Robb gained a position at the start of the 85-lap event but ended up losing a position by the time a full course caution came out on Lap 20.
- The rookie took advantage of the caution to make his first pit stop on Lap 22.
- Unfortunately, Robb was then penalized for a pit lane speed violation which sent him to the back of the field.
- He was running 24th when racing resumed on Lap 26.
- Robb then made his way up to 19th before making his second pit stop on Lap 54.
- The rookie continued to run strong for the remainder of the race, taking the checkered flag for the first time this season in 18th.
